‘Europe and the other’

2015-2016

Four debates on Europe facing a globalised world

Europe is clearly finding it difficult to find its place in a new, so-called “globalised”, world. What relationship has Europe managed to define in regard to the other or “others” so that its place – which cannot be the same as in the past – is clear to itself and to others? Four debates centred around the core subject of identity-otherness will attempt to answer this difficult question. Underlying them is the idea that the analysis of the relationship with the other makes it possible to shed light on what we, Europeans, are today and will be tomorrow.
